How much do data engineering consultant j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 7, 2026, the average hourly pay for data engineering consultant in the United States is $44.89,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$30.29 and $60.10 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a data engineering consultant?

To thrive as a Data Engineering Consultant, you need strong programming skills (e.g., Python, SQL), expertise in data modeling, and a background in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with cloud platforms (such as AWS, Azure, or GCP), ETL tools, and data warehousing systems is typically required, along with relevant certifications. Excellent problem-solving, communication, and project management skills help consultants effectively translate business needs into technical solutions and collaborate with stakeholders. These skills are crucial for designing robust, scalable data architectures that drive actionable insights and meet client objectives.

What are some common challenges faced by data engineering consultants when working with clients, and how can they be addressed?

Data Engineering Consultants often encounter challenges such as integrating data from disparate sources, ensuring data quality, and aligning technical solutions with client business goals. Successfully addressing these issues involves strong communication skills to clarify requirements, a deep understanding of modern data platforms, and the ability to recommend scalable architectures. Building trust with stakeholders and proactively managing expectations are also key to overcoming obstacles and delivering impactful results.

What does a data engineering consultant do?

A Data Engineering Consultant helps organizations design, build, and optimize systems for collecting, storing, and analyzing large volumes of data. They work with clients to understand their data needs, recommend appropriate technologies, and implement solutions that support data-driven decision making. Their role often includes integrating data from different sources, ensuring data quality, and optimizing data pipelines for performance and scalability. Data Engineering Consultants also provide guidance on best practices and may assist in training in-house teams.

What is the difference between Data Engineering Consultant vs Data Analyst?

AspectData Engineering ConsultantData Analyst
Required CredentialsBachelor's/Master's in CS, Data Science, or related; certifications like AWS, Azure, GCPBachelor's in Statistics, Math, or related; certifications like Microsoft Data Analyst
Work EnvironmentDesigning data pipelines, building infrastructure, working with cloud platformsAnalyzing data sets, creating reports, visualizations, and insights
Employer & Industry UsageTech companies, consulting firms, finance, healthcareMarketing agencies, finance, retail, healthcare

While both roles work with data, Data Engineering Consultants focus on building and maintaining data infrastructure, whereas Data Analysts interpret data to provide insights. The roles often collaborate but require different skill sets and tools.
